What is ultra-low latency and why is it important?

Latency is the time between the moment an order is submitted and its execution on the broker's server. On average, latency on a traditional VPS is 20–50 ms, but on Tier-1 servers located near broker data centers in London, Frankfurt, or New York, it drops to 0.5–1 ms .
This is critical for HFT (High-Frequency Trading) and scalping. Even a 5-ms difference can change the entry price and impact the trade outcome, especially when trading EUR/USD or GBP/USD.

Technologies of 2025: From Edge Networks to AI Monitoring

Modern VPS providers use:

Edge infrastructure – physical proximity of servers to exchanges.
AI traffic monitoring that predicts network congestion.
NVMe SSD and DDR5 , accelerating data processing up to 2.5 GB/s.

Adaptive Latency Routing — real-time packet routing to shorten the path from the trader to the broker.

Example: Brokers integrated with Equinix NY4 achieve a response time of 0.6 ms, while with a direct connection via the FIX API, it reaches up to 0.3 ms.


In 2025, the largest low-latency infrastructure centers are concentrated in London, Singapore, Tokyo, and New York . These centers are home to leading brokers, including IC Markets, Pepperstone, and Exness.
According to BIS, around 38% of global retail Forex trading volume is processed through VPS platforms , and the use of latency services has grown by 26% year-on-year .

Risk management and compliance

Speed ​​shouldn't compromise control. Proprietary firms and brokers use latency logging to record the exact execution time of orders and ensure transparency for regulators (CySEC, FCA, ASIC).
In addition, many brokers are implementing AI compliance models that monitor for suspicious “spike trades” – attempts to exploit microlags to manipulate prices.
